1749 July 27.

The Place of Organist Declared Vacant by the,
Decease of Mr. Philip Hart< no role >


The Names of the Several Candidates
The Salary of Organist to be £30 P Annum & chose
Annually
The Person to be chosen Organist to Attend in Person
twice on every Sunday & on other usual Festivals & to
have no Deputy but In Case of Sickness
The sevl. Candidates to play Alphabetically
A Motion made the Election shod. be by Ballot But not
Declaracon made.

Septr. 27.

A Vestry held to Determine on a Method for Election
of Organist & to fix upon a Day for Such Election,
Order of Vestry of 27th. July last read
Order of Vestry of 12 December 1738. Read
Mr Church Warden Branch Delivered in at the Table
a Letter wrote to Sir Jos: Hankey< no role > Knt . by Mr. Adams< no role >
Recorder of London relating to Elections
The Letter Ordered to be Read
A Question was proposed wher. the Election of An
Organist shod. be by Ballot or Pell but Great Debates
arising [..] the Question was not putt. Adjourned} 377. 378

Octor: 11.

Order of Vestry for a Church Rate379


Mr Church Warden Branch Empowered to pay £30
Assessed on this Parish by An Act of Comen Council towards
the Support of the London Workhouse
